Fascinating pigeon facts that might surprise you.
A single pigeon produces about 25 pounds of droppings per year, which can corrode metal and damage building facades.
Pigeon droppings are highly acidic (pH 3-4.5) and can eat through car paint, concrete, and roofing materials.
Pigeons have been domesticated for over 5,000 years — they were the first bird humans ever domesticated.
Feral pigeon populations can double in just 2 months under ideal conditions.
Pigeons can recognize all 26 letters of the English alphabet and can even be trained to distinguish between paintings by Monet and Picasso.
A flock of just 100 pigeons can produce over 2,400 pounds of droppings in a single year.

DIY vs. Professional Pigeon Control in Helenaretail-store-bird-solutions
| DIY Method | Effectiveness | Limitation |
|---|---|---|
| Ultrasonic devices | Minimal proven effectiveness | Most peer-reviewed studies show negligible impact on pigeon behavior |
| Removing food sources | Helpful as part of a broader plan | Urban environments provide too many alternative food sources for this alone |
| Sealing individual entry points | Effective for specific openings | Pigeons find alternative entry points without comprehensive exclusion |
| Bird gel or sticky repellent | Mildly effective on flat ledges | Collects dust and debris quickly, loses stickiness, and can trap small songbirds |
| Homemade spice or vinegar sprays | Very short-term deterrent | Washes away with rain and requires constant reapplication |
